Output ecbc976c7966a973e96713e062184b1edb47bf61d15771646b1e96978a42532f:1

value
1843144
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 75540043b5a3bf6c7fc168a4e4f927a53bac7318 OP_EQUALVERIFY OP_CHECKSIG
address
1BhNgwRKaLArvTiBs1hkea7VVaYxv74d65
transaction
ecbc976c7966a973e96713e062184b1edb47bf61d15771646b1e96978a42532f
confirmations
470275
spent
true